The Importance Of DNA Paternity Testing

DNA paternity testing is a scientific method used to confirm the biological relationship between a father and a child It has become increasingly common in today’s society, as it provides a reliable and accurate way to determine paternity This testing can have a significant impact on individuals and families, providing clarity and peace of mind in situations where doubt or uncertainty exists.

Paternity testing is often used in legal cases, such as child support and custody disputes In these situations, the results of a DNA test can have a direct impact on the outcome of the case It can also be used to establish inheritance rights and benefits for a child Additionally, many individuals choose to undergo paternity testing for personal reasons, such as confirming a biological relationship or establishing a bond with a child.

The process of DNA paternity testing involves collecting samples from the alleged father and the child These samples typically include cheek swabs or blood samples, which are then sent to a laboratory for analysis The DNA from each sample is compared to determine if there is a genetic match between the father and the child This comparison is based on the unique genetic markers that are passed down from parent to child.

One of the key benefits of DNA paternity testing is its accuracy DNA testing has a very high level of accuracy, with results that are considered to be over 99.9% accurate This level of accuracy makes DNA testing the gold standard for paternity testing, as it provides definitive results that are admissible in court.
